I am a passionate, motivated and highly adaptable engineer with a wealth of experience in front- and back-end programming, architecture for scalable back-ends (from APIs to fully-featured web apps), and managing rock-solid production in infrastructure. Above all, I value best engineering practice, including CI/CD, secure design and test-driven development. In my most recent roles, I have led web application feature development and contributed directly through hands-on programming, primarily with PHP (Slim API, Symfony), Python (FastAPI, Django) and TypeScript (React). I have championed serverless AWS in infrastructure as code tools, and have also led a data engineering team; during this time I delivered a greenfield data platform that transformed the company’s data analytics function, again leveraging AWS services, including S3, Kafka, Glue, Athena and Redshift.

I am a passionate, motivated and highly adaptable engineer with a wealth of experience in front- and back-end programming, architecture for scalable back-ends (from APIs to fully-featured web apps), and managing rock-solid production in infrastructure. Above all, I value best engineering practice, including CI/CD, secure design and test-driven development. In my most recent roles, I have led web application feature development and contributed directly through hands-on programming, primarily with PHP (Slim API, Symfony), Python (FastAPI, Django) and TypeScript (React). I have championed serverless AWS in infrastructure as code tools, and have also led a data engineering team; during this time I delivered a greenfield data platform that transformed the company’s data analytics function, again leveraging AWS services, including S3, Kafka, Glue, Athena and Redshift.

Available to hire

I am a passionate, motivated and highly adaptable engineer with a wealth of experience in front- and back-end programming, architecture for scalable back-ends (from APIs to fully-featured web apps), and managing rock-solid production in infrastructure.

Above all, I value best engineering practice, including CI/CD, secure design and test-driven development. In my most recent roles, I have led web application feature development and contributed directly through hands-on programming, primarily with PHP (Slim API, Symfony), Python (FastAPI, Django) and TypeScript (React). I have championed serverless AWS in infrastructure as code tools, and have also led a data engineering team; during this time I delivered a greenfield data platform that transformed the company’s data analytics function, again leveraging AWS services, including S3, Kafka, Glue, Athena and Redshift.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
See more

Language

English
Fluent

Work Experience

Full-Stack Developer at Jisc
May 1, 2025 - November 1, 2025
Designed and built a new AWS infrastructure using Terraform, CDK and Chef; upgraded the system using PHP and TypeScript, introducing TDD; implemented CI/CD and containerised development environment to modernise the workflow.
Full-Stack Developer at UCheck
October 1, 2023 - April 30, 2025
Developed migration tools using Core PHP, SQL, Python and AWS; introduced integration and end-to-end testing to improve confidence and stability; modernised a legacy codebase with improved SOLID principles and added front-end testing with Jest; led adoption of Docker and Terraform to establish IaC and containerisation practices.
Senior Software Engineer at Efficio Ltd.
May 1, 2016 - August 31, 2023
Led re-architecture of the data platform to enable real-time analytics; built a Python suite leveraging Lambda, SQS, SNS, Kafka, Glue and Athena to power internal and client analytics; formed a unified data lake on AWS using Lake Formation, S3 and Glue; steered end-to-end development of the company's web app using microservices and REST/event-driven APIs; oversaw AWS migration; contributed to ISO27001 security certification; delivered training and thought leadership.

Education

BSc (Hons) IT in Organizations at University of Southampton
May 1, 2009 - April 30, 2012
MSc in Software and Systems Engineering at Kellogg College, University of Oxford
May 1, 2018 - July 31, 2020

Qualifications

ISO27001 Certification
January 11, 2030 - January 13, 2026

Industry Experience

Software & Internet, Professional Services, Media & Entertainment